Feline spongiform encephalopathy

Feline spongiform encephalopathy (FSE) is a neurodegenerative disease that affects the brains of felines. This disease is known to affect domestic, captive, and wild species of the family Felidae. Like BSE, this disease can take several years to develop. It is currently believed that this condition is a result of felines ingesting bovine meat contaminated with BSE.
